Backflow Testing: What You Need to Know


How Does Backflow Testing Work?


The goal of a backflow test is to ensure the home’s backflow preventer valves work correctly. A backflow preventer valve is in the connections within the home’s plumbing. The valves are installed at various locations throughout the system in any area in which a risk of water backflow can enter the plumbing system.



Once you contact a plumber to check your water, the first step is to turn the downstream shut-off valve. After a few moments, the plumber will test your valves by using a hose and gauge as the valves are opened and closed. The gauge will tell the plumber whether or not the valves are functioning correctly.



Additionally, the plumber will inspect any other obvious signs of backflow in your clean water to see if they correlate with the malfunctioning preventer valves.



How Can You Tell If a Backflow Preventer Valve Is Bad?


There are several signs you have a bad backflow preventer valve. One obvious sign is a foul smell coming from different areas in your home. A sulfur or rotten egg smell can begin to emit as the contaminated water backs up in your plumbing system.



You will also notice a slow flow as water drains from sinks, tubs, and toilets. The water can become yellow or brown in color, and particles or sediment may be present in the water flow. Your drinking water may also begin to have a bad taste.



How Can You Prevent Issues with Your Backflow Preventer Valves?


The best way to prevent any issues with your backflow preventer valves is through regular inspection. A licensed plumber will come to your home on an annual basis to ensure the plumbing system works correctly. This step will help ensure your home’s water is clean, safe, and free from contaminants.
